Unsure of current ob burning with urination for 9 days

Hi,
I have been experiencing a burning sensation when I pee for the last week and a half. Originally thought since I had no promdrol symptoms that it was a uti as I am also prone to those. I was diagnosed with herpes by swab of lesion exactly a year ago and all outbreaks have had promdrol symptoms. After antibiotics (from a walk in clinic) the pain was still there I went to my dr who said it was an ob. She said there was a lesion on my urethra. I can't see any lesion. I have been on antivirals for 9 days now with little to no improvement on the burning. Which makes me think how can this be an ob?  I see her On Wednesday and will as for a swab of whatever lesion she thinks is there that I can't see.  I am just wondering wldnt the antivirals have at least stopped the burning by now? And this is a strange ob as well as an unusually long one. Somedays it's not burning as badly when I pee but then I wake up the next morning and whatever improvement I felt the day before is gone and I am back to the pain. Can you share some insight for me please? I am confused and frustrated that this will not go away and I can't perform a normal bodily function without pain searing through me.

far, far too late to swab anything there. It's been too long time wise as well as you took a round of antivirals. don't even waste your time with a lesion culture at this point.

is it likely this is herpes? no it is not. Your herpes would've cleared on its own by now even without antivirals.
